How do you post on Reddit without sounding promotional?

The 9:1 rule: for every self-promotional post, you should have nine posts that contribute without a link to your product. Reddit's spam filter and its community are both harsher than any other platform. When you do post about your own work, frame it as a story or a lesson, not an announcement — "What I learned shipping X" beats "Check out my new product." Engage with comments as yourself, not as a marketing account. Subreddits have specific rules — read them, some ban any self-promotion outright. Post where your users actually hang out, not where you wish they did. And never post the same message across multiple subreddits at once; Reddit detects and shadowbans that.
